Output c6e242c05b63f899a3f216793c175673674dfdb88f799ec8e7c0c5d0bebd558c:0

value
52003290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83d0b26f33999030905713be103d0de975819caa OP_EQUAL
address
3DhzTCKT5M3gaQ7H4PfdCoAkte6DnYUuoW
transaction
c6e242c05b63f899a3f216793c175673674dfdb88f799ec8e7c0c5d0bebd558c
confirmations
347950
spent
true